Sorel Niles IL
Add Website
Close
Sorel
Be first to review 8901 N Milwaukee Ave,Niles IL 60714 Phone Number: (847) 967-8172
Sorel Store Hours
Hours may fluctuate
Post a review
Sorel Nearby
Locations Closest to You miles-
Sorel - Niles 7233 W Dempster St1.07
-
Sorel - Glenview 1900 Tower Dr3.29
-
Sorel - Glenview Glenview3.40